Black Jade Case
The Black Jade Case is a restrictive treasure container whose acquisition, custody, or use materially affects the story.
History
Acquisition, use, and later custody
Cha Hong spends roughly a century breaking its restriction; Qin Yu takes the opened case after the underground battle. (Chapters 122–133)
Abilities and properties
- Restrictive container holding the eighth jade sword. (Chapters 122–133)
